Introduction to Crop Rotation

Crop rotation is an agricultural technique that has been practiced for thousands of years. It involves changing the type of crops grown in a particular area across different seasons. This method helps maintain soil fertility and reduce soil erosion, thereby promoting sustainable farming practices.


How Crop Rotation Works

Crop rotation typically involves a planned sequence of different crops. By rotating crops, farmers can break pest cycles, improve soil structure, and increase nutrient availability. For example, planting legumes after a cereal crop can replenish nitrogen levels in the soil, owing to the legumes’ ability to fix atmospheric nitrogen.


Benefits of Crop Rotation

  • Improved Soil Health: Different crops contribute various nutrients to the soil, which enhances soil health and fertility.
  • Pest and Disease Management: Crop rotation can disrupt the lifecycle of pests and diseases, reducing their prevalence without relying heavily on chemical treatments.
  • Higher Yields: By replenishing soil nutrients and reducing pests and diseases, crop rotation can lead to improved crop yields over time.
  • Environmental Benefits: Crop rotation supports biodiversity and reduces the need for chemical fertilizers and pesticides, making it an environmentally sustainable practice.

Implementing Crop Rotation

To implement crop rotation effectively, farmers need to plan which crops are rotated and in what sequence. Farmers should consider factors such as crop compatibility, soil type, and local climate conditions. A common approach is a three-field system where fields alternate between legumes, grains, and a fallow period or root crops.


Conclusion

Crop rotation is a tried-and-tested agricultural practice that boosts soil health, manages pests, and increases agricultural productivity. By understanding the principles and benefits of crop rotation, farmers can optimize their farming operations for sustainability and success.
